2 Interesting Facts Continent: Africa Population: 54 million
Capital: Cape Town, Bloemfontein, Pretoria Table Mountain alone has over 1,500 species of plants, more than the entire United Kingdom. South Africa is the second largest exporter of fruit in the world. South Africa is the only country in the world to voluntarily abandon its nuclear weapons program.
